files like
../../C:/hello.cc are recognized as valid filenames by cvs version. Is it
valid?
That is a valid file name on GNU or Unix. Perhaps on MS Windows it is
not. However, if compile.el recognizes impossible file names if they
appear in an error message, that is not necessarily a problem. It
only becomes a problem if this leads to incorrect parsing of error
messages that really occur.
